Complex Carbohydrates: The Superior Choice

While the body can derive energy from various carbohydrate sources, not all are created equal. The most important sources of carbohydrates are complex carbohydrates found in whole, unprocessed, or minimally processed plant-based foods. These include whole grains, vegetables, legumes, and fruits. Unlike simple carbohydrates, which are quickly digested and cause rapid blood sugar spikes, complex carbohydrates are digested slowly, providing a sustained release of energy. This steady energy supply is crucial for maintaining stable blood sugar levels, preventing the energy crashes often associated with sugary foods.

Why Complex Carbs Matter for Health

Complex carbohydrates come packaged with essential vitamins, minerals, fiber, and phytonutrients that are vital for proper bodily function. This rich nutritional profile is largely stripped away from refined simple carbohydrates during processing. The high fiber content in complex carbs also plays a significant role in digestive health. Fiber adds bulk to stool, aiding digestion, and can help lower cholesterol levels and manage blood sugar. A diet rich in high-quality, complex carbs has been linked to a lower risk of obesity, heart disease, and type 2 diabetes.

Limiting Refined Simple Carbohydrates

On the other end of the spectrum are refined simple carbohydrates, which should be limited. These include foods with added sugars and those made from refined grains, such as white bread, pastries, and soda. These items provide what are often called "empty calories" because they offer little nutritional value beyond a quick burst of energy. Consuming too many of these can contribute to weight gain, inflammation, and increase the risk of chronic diseases. The key is not to eliminate carbs entirely but to choose quality over quantity, swapping refined grains for their whole-grain counterparts.

Key Sources of Healthy Carbohydrates

  • Whole Grains: Oats, brown rice, quinoa, barley, and whole-wheat bread and pasta. Look for "whole grain" listed as the first ingredient.
  • Legumes: Lentils, chickpeas, black beans, and kidney beans are excellent sources of both carbohydrates and protein, along with fiber.
  • Starchy Vegetables: Sweet potatoes, corn, and peas are packed with nutrients and fiber, especially when eaten with the skin on.
  • Fruits: Whole fruits like berries, apples, and bananas offer natural sugars alongside essential vitamins and fiber. Always opt for whole fruit over juice to get the full fiber benefits.
  • Non-Starchy Vegetables: Broccoli, cauliflower, and leafy greens contain low amounts of carbs but are incredibly nutrient-dense, filling out a balanced meal.

Comparison Table: Complex vs. Simple Carbohydrates

Feature Complex Carbohydrates Simple Carbohydrates
Digestion Speed Slower, sustained release of glucose Faster, rapid release of glucose
Blood Sugar Impact Gradually raises blood sugar levels Causes rapid spikes and crashes in blood sugar
Nutritional Value High in fiber, vitamins, and minerals Often low in nutrients (empty calories)
Satiety Keeps you feeling full for longer Causes quick hunger to return
Health Effects Supports heart health, weight management, and digestive function Linked to weight gain and increased risk of chronic disease
Examples Whole grains, vegetables, beans, lentils Table sugar, candy, soda, white bread

The Physiological Role of Carbohydrates

The glucose derived from carbohydrate digestion is the primary fuel source for the body's cells, particularly the brain, which requires about 130 grams of glucose daily just to function. When glucose is not needed immediately, it is stored in the liver and muscles as glycogen for later use during exercise or between meals. Consuming enough carbs prevents the body from breaking down protein from muscle tissue for energy, a process known as protein sparing. Fiber, a complex carb that the body cannot digest, is crucial for maintaining a healthy gut microbiome and ensuring regular bowel movements.
